With all the roof design and styles that you can choose in the market today, you probably need a little help to push you to the ideal direction. Correct planning and substantial time ought to be allocated in selecting the best roofing style that would best fit your house. Roofings considerably contribute to the appearance you desire your home to portray.
In thinking about timeless roofing styles, you'll perhaps discover the variety nearly unlimited. Timeless roofing typically requires a considerable quantity of workmanship and competence. That is why aside from choosing premium grade materials, it is equally essential to hire just the finest roofing contractors in your area.
Typically, the usage recycled roof products are perfectly proper to assist you in accomplishing the traditional roof style to desire to pull off. It is also suggested to utilize the light-weight, synthetic products if you like the standard, classic roofing design.
conventional roof products frequently utilized frequently can not stand up to high winds and other serious weather condition aspects as effectively as artificial materials. There are steel tiles which are designed to look like timeless roofing tile however with the benefit of much easier installation and considerably cheaper too. Artificial roofing products are readily available in different styles and textures that you can pick from to achieve the look you seek for your roofing. The synthetic traditional roof will not just offer you the defense and protection against harsh weather, you can with confidence anticipate it to last longer than the standard cedar or slate roofings.
There are numerous more recent slates and imitation shakes that are really filled with rubber substances, making it capable to better hinder the hazardous UV rays, and more resilient and fire resistant. Synthetic materials are significantly a lot easier to set up using air pressured nail weapons.
Be sure to assess the advantages of every choice when first choosing the design of roof to wish to adjust. Choose which design that will best enhance the appeal of your house, and would still offer the toughness that you require.

A flat roof system works by providing a waterproof membrane over a structure. It includes one or more layers of hydrophobic products that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is normally positioned in between the roofing system and the deck memb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other building parts to avoid water infiltration.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and gutters by the roof's small pitch.
There are four most typical types of flat roofing system systems. Listed in order of increasing resilience and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can vary an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is used over and existing roof,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ofs.
Used because the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ing typically cons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ated natural or fiberglass base felts that are used over roofing system fel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and typically covered with a granular mineral surface. The joints are usually covered over with a roof compound.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roof is the latest type of roof material. It is frequently utilized to change multiple-ply roofing systems. 10 to 12 year guarantees are typical, but appropriate setup is vital and upkeep is still required.
Built-up or multiple-ply roof, also referred to as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or layered felts or mats that are sprinkled with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roofing ballast, sheet, or tile pavers that are utilized to protect the underlying materials from the weather condition. BURs are developed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the materials used.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finish of asphalt or coal tar. Since the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and preserving the joints of the roofing system challenging.
Lastly, flat-seamed roofings have been utilized because the 19 th century. Made from small p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last many decades depending on the quality of the material, direct exposure, and upkeep to the elements.
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to prevent deterioration and split seams require to be resoldered. Other metal surfaces,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and typically need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are favored as long-lasting flat roofs.
